The variety is a two-row barley, described in scientific literature as a genetic resource or historical form. The plants are characterized by the presence of smooth awns, and the average number of stem internodes is 22.9.
The primary purpose of the variety is malting. It possessed specific resistance to diseases, in particular to powdery mildew, due to the presence of the Mla9 gene; however, over time, the variety lost its relevance for mass production due to pathogens overcoming this protection.
